Today, AI stops at the code layer because infrastructure context is fragmented and inaccessible. Bluebricks maps your cloud resources, their relationships, and your organizational guardrails into a unified, structured layer. This allows agents to discover what exists, understand how everything is connected, and execute infrastructure tasks reliably.
Instead of giving agents direct, risky access to cloud APIs, they operate through Bluebricks, which handles orchestration, dependency management, policy enforcement, and auditability.
The result: AI agents that can complete infrastructure tasks end-to-end, safely, deterministically, and without human handoffs.
